Akariya Geihanro
Akariya Geihanro is a charming hotel in the historic city of Inuyama, Japan.

Nestled along the Kiso River, it offers guests a tranquil escape with picturesque views and a serene atmosphere. The hotel’s traditional architecture beautifully complements its natural surroundings, creating an authentic Japanese experience.
One of the highlights of Akariya Geihanro is its proximity to notable attractions such as Inuyama Castle, one of Japan’s oldest surviving castles. Guests can easily explore this iconic site and appreciate its historical significance. Nearby, the delightful Urakuen Garden provides a peaceful retreat for those interested in traditional Japanese landscaping and tea ceremonies.
The hotel is also conveniently located for visits to the Meiji Mura Museum, where visitors can witness preserved buildings from Japan’s Meiji era. For nature enthusiasts, Monkey Park offers both entertainment and adventure amid lush greenery.
In terms of amenities, Akariya Geihanro prides itself on delivering exceptional hospitality with personalized service. The rooms are comfortable and blend traditional design elements with modern conveniences.
However, some guests might find that the limited range of facilities may not cater to those seeking a wide array of activities within the hotel complex itself.
Overall, Akariya Geihanro stands out for its cultural proximity and serene environment in Inuyama.
